Diving deeper into odds and statistics unveils the fact of lottery participation. Statistically, each quantity has an equal chance of being drawn, but many gamers exhibit a bent to choose specific numbers based mostly both on private significance or popular patterns. For occasion, birthdays and anniversaries typically affect selections, main many to select numbers between 1 and 31. As a end result, the likelihood of sharing a jackpot increases if these commonly chosen numbers turn into winning mixtures. This highlights the discrepancy between perceived and actual possibilities within the lottery, where understanding true randomness can affect ticket choices. The allure of predicting profitable numbers has captivated players. Some may turn to past successful numbers, astrology, and even numerology, in hopes of deciphering a sample that might give them an edge. However, lottery drawings are impartial occasions governed by comprehensive randomization processes, making previous outcomes irrelevant for future draws. Mathematically, which means every quantity mixture has an equal opportunity to emerge in each draw, regardless of its past frequency. For example, assumptions like "hot" numbers that incessantly appear or "cold" numbers that seldom don't hold up under scrutiny. All mixtures retain an equal likelihood of winning, and the result of 1 draw does not affect the following. Consequently, any strategies involving predictions are mere hypothesis missing a grounding in statistical proof.
